Transaction ccfacb4d42edd50c91c4523bd1ad53a9e70f6e4a35f3a3e2f54d684b787ad111
1 Input
1 Output
-
ccfacb4d42edd50c91c4523bd1ad53a9e70f6e4a35f3a3e2f54d684b787ad111:0
- value
- 3328436
- script pubkey
- OP_0 OP_PUSHBYTES_32 ea77962cd4a6932c2b8c13b9b312613c4407a091de84f0b8108ff155fb55c844
- address
- bc1qafmevtx556fjc2uvzwumxynp83zq0gy3m6z0pwqs3lc4t764epzqnlhaps